On Thursday, August 25, 2011 12:52:11 Marek Szyprowski wrote:
> This patch changes the order of operations during stream on call. Now the
> buffers are first queued to the driver and then the start_streaming method
> is called.
> 
> This resolves the most common case when the driver needs to know buffer
> addresses to enable dma engine and start streaming. Additional parameters
> to start_streaming and buffer_queue methods have been added to simplify
> drivers code. The driver are now obliged to check if the number of queued
> buffers is enough to enable hardware streaming. If not - it should return
> an error. In such case all the buffers that have been pre-queued are
> invalidated.
> 
> Drivers that are able to start/stop streaming on-fly, can control dma
> engine directly in buf_queue callback. In this case start_streaming
> callback can be considered as optional. The driver can also assume that
> after a few first buf_queue calls with zero 'streaming' parameter, the core
> will finally call start_streaming callback.

> diff --git a/include/media/videobuf2-core.h b/include/media/videobuf2-core.h
> index 5287e90..412daf0 100644
> --- a/include/media/videobuf2-core.h
> +++ b/include/media/videobuf2-core.h
> @@ -196,15 +196,23 @@ struct vb2_buffer {
>   *                     before userspace accesses the buffer; optional
>   * @buf_cleanup:       called once before the buffer is freed; drivers may
>   *                     perform any additional cleanup; optional
> - * @start_streaming:   called once before entering 'streaming' state; enables
> - *                     driver to receive buffers over buf_queue() callback
> + * @start_streaming:   called once to enter 'streaming' state; the driver may
> + *                     receive buffers with @buf_queue callback before
> + *                     @start_streaming is called; the driver gets the number
> + *                     of already queued buffers in count parameter; driver
> + *                     can return an error if hardware fails or not enough
> + *                     buffers has been queued, in such case all buffers that
> + *                     have been already given by the @buf_queue callback are
> + *                     invalidated.
>   * @stop_streaming:    called when 'streaming' state must be disabled; driver
>   *                     should stop any DMA transactions or wait until they
>   *                     finish and give back all buffers it got from buf_queue()
>   *                     callback; may use vb2_wait_for_all_buffers() function
>   * @buf_queue:         passes buffer vb to the driver; driver may start
>   *                     hardware operation on this buffer; driver should give
> - *                     the buffer back by calling vb2_buffer_done() function
> + *                     the buffer back by calling vb2_buffer_done() function;
> + *                     'streaming' parameter tells driver wheather streaming
> + *                     state has been enabled not.
>   */
